Cheeks

Huda Glo Wish Cheeky Blush is velvety blush with a marbled formula developed to give all skin tones a beautifully natural, fresh-faced flush of colour and a soft-focus glow. It comes in four shades. Infused with antioxidants and skin-loving ingredients this non-powdery, skin-blurring blush gives your cheeks a silky wash of colour that’s super buildable! Tip - You can use an angled blush to be on trend or just pop it on the apples of your cheeks for a more classic look.

Eyes

Make applying eyeshadow simple and easy with this collection of creamy eyeshadow sticks designed to glide easily onto your eyelids. AYU’s Cream Eye Shadow Pencil Set (€60 for set of six) is great for precision and definitive lines or for an all over quick, fuss free application. No mess, no hassle! These fast setting, crease-proof and perfectly pigmented eye shadows are designed for long wearing colour that will take you from day to night. The colours included in this set are burgundy, olive, plum, white gold, bronze and dusty pink. These pencils are available to purchase individually also and retail at €12.

Meanwhile AYU has selection of luxurious, richly pigmented eye shadow palettes that offer a selection of shades in smooth matte and soft satin finishes streamlined to include everything you need to create a beautiful modern eye look. To complement the best-selling Signature and Glamour palettes, two brand new additions have recently been added to the range. These are the Emerald Eye Shadow Palette and the Sapphire Eye Shadow Palette.

My tip for eyes is to use the lower lash line as the place for the colour pop if you are nervous about using it all over the lid.

Lashes

The Essence Lash Princess Curl & Volume mascara is the latest addition to the popular mascara range and a real eye-catcher with its unique design and catchy pink colour code.

The true highlight is the peanut-shaped brush. Similar to the shape of a peanut, the fibre brush is narrow in the middle and wider at the ends. This provides the lashes on the outer and inner corners of the eye with extra texture and makes them look even fuller – for a perfect curl and fantastic volume.

Doubling it up with the new, innovative Double Trouble mascara in a super bold design offers everything that beauty lovers dream of in a mascara in one product. Because sometimes, one mascara just isn't tnough, this innovative two-in-one brush has two ends. One elastomer side for extra volume and an endless look and a fibre side for definition and curl.

Tip - Use the waterproof version if you have leaky eyes or a commute to work.
